Stew Leonard Recall Issued

Stew Leonard’s issued a voluntary recall of select apple pie products due to potential allergen concerns. The recall affects Apple Crisp made with Honeycrisp Apples and No Sugar Apple Pie, sold at seven Stew Leonard’s locations across Connecticut, and also in New York and New Jersey between Aug. 28, 2023, and March 8th of this year. Undeclared milk and eggs pose risks to consumers with allergies. Fortunately, no illnesses have been reported so far. Check your pantry for affected products.
